SubjectRe: [PATCH v3 40/71] ARC: OProfile support
On Tuesday 29 January 2013 10:35 PM, James Hogan wrote:
> Hi Vineet,
>
> You don't appear to define CONFIG_HW_PERF_EVENTS, so
> include/linux/oprofile.h will presumably define oprofile_perf_init as
> just a pr_info(...); return -ENODEV;
>
> Similarly drivers/oprofile/oprofile_perf.o doesn't seem to be being built.
>
> I'm probably missing something somewhere?

Not much :-)

oprofile_arch_init() failure causes oprofile to fall back to timer based PC only
sampling - for coarse grained profiling. I'll soon be starting on integratign the
hardware counter support to both oprofile/perf.

FWIW, I just re-verified that latest upstream OProfile works fine with 3.8 kernel.
